How to Improve Your Online Privacy Today

Want to strengthen your internet privacy immediately? It’s easier than you imagine. Start by examining your web history and wiping your browsing data. Next, activate two-factor security on your key accounts. Consider using a secure platform like DuckDuckGo and installing a reputable VPN to mask your IP connection. Finally, be careful of the details you share on platforms – your online footprint counts !
